Ashisogi Jizou
Ichigo was walking leisurely through the streets of the seireitei. Something suddenly collided into his midsection, knocking the wind out of his lungs and almost bowling him over. Stumbling back a few steps, he sent his gaze towards his assailant.
Simply put, it looked like some kind of freak experiment. A large, bald and golden baby head with blank white eyes sat on top of a limbless green body held afloat by a pair of butterfly wings sprouting from its back. The teenage substitute blinked, trying to see if he was hallucinating. The weird being was still floating in front of him, its head slightly tilted in what looked like confusion.
"What the hell?" he muttered. The thing gave an unintelligible chirrup. A second later, it zoomed over to behind his back in a panicked fashion. Before he could protest, someone else suddenly appeared before him. It was a young woman with an expressionless face and purple hair in a single braid. Nemu Kurotsuchi, Mayuri's artificial daughter. Ichigo felt the weird creature press itself against him from behind, shuddering.
"Ichigo Kurosaki," Nemu acknowledged in her usual monotone. "I'm looking for a zanpakto spirit."
"You know, you'll have to be more specific than that," he replied, although he had a sneaking suspicion on what her target actually was.
"Ashisogi Jizou," she told him almost instantly.
A figurative question mark appeared over the teen's head. "What?"
"Mayuri-sama's zanpakto spirit. It has a baby's head and butterfly wings," Nemu elaborated. "I can vaguely sense it around the vicinity, but am unable to pinpoint it."
Ichigo felt the now named Ashisogi Jizou tremble against him even more. That was more than slightly concerning, that Mayuri's zanpakto was afraid of going to his second in command and by extension him as well. The creep probably wanted to run some twisted experiment on it. Ichigo considered it a good thing that his ridiculously overflowing spiritual power was interfering with her sensory capabilities. "Well, I did see something like that just before you came," he admitted. "But it dashed off and I can't see it anymore. That's probably why you can detect the spiritual pressure but not pinpoint it."
Nemu nodded in acceptance. "That does sound likely. Very well, I shall take my leave. Sorry for troubling you." Without another word, she turned around and vanished in a burst of flash-step.
Releasing a big sigh, the orange-haired soul reaper turned around to face Ashisogi Jizou. "It's alright little guy, she's gone now," he assured. "I'd prefer if you didn't stick around with me though. I don't want your creepy master coming after me."
The zanpakto manifestation nodded in understanding and appreciation. Its mouth twitched into a small smile and it gave an affirmative chirrup. It rotated in mid-air before flying off with surprising speed.
"Well that happened," Ichigo remarked. "Did Mayuri's zanpakto always look like that, or is it because he already modified it? Actually, I don't even want to know."
